Visceral fat: how to get rid of excess

Scientists say that some fat is necessary for a person. It is involved in the regulation of body temperature, protects our joints. But excess fat mass can lead to the development of many serious diseases, from stroke to cancer. In the human body, there are three types of fat deposits with different levels of metabolism:

  • Subcutaneous fat;

  • Fat, which is determined by sex. In women, it is 12% (fat in the chest, buttocks, thighs), in men (necessary fat) - 3%;

  • Visceral or internal fat.

Fat accumulating under the skin, of course, causes some inconvenience, spoils the mood, but subcutaneous fat is a problem most likely aesthetic, it does not lead to loss of health.

Another type of fat, visceral, presents a health hazard. It accumulates in the abdominal region: around the internal organs, in large vessels. By enveloping internal organs, it changes their work, affects the metabolic processes. Inner fat can penetrate into muscle tissue, and sometimes even into internal organs and often into the heart.

Visceral fat is invisible, it is dangerous because it negatively affects the hormonal background: in men it lowers testosterone levels, and in women increases the level of prolactin. Unlike subcutaneous fat, it periodically throws fatty acids into the blood, which leads to the formation of cholesterol plaques, one of the causes of hypertension. Consequently, this fat is much more dangerous than the subcutaneous fat. In addition, visceral fat is not always visible, you can have a normal weight, but you can have more visceral fat than you think. It produces metabolic substances and about 30 hormones that negatively affect the walls of the arteries of the brain and heart, damaging them. And this provokes strokes, heart attacks and cancer. It is known that in men visceral fat is more due to the action of sex hormones. Fat deposits of men are most often concentrated in the abdomen, while in women the main problem areas are the sides, buttocks, hips. After 40 years, when the level of estrogen in a woman decreases, fat passes into the abdomen.

Scientists believe that the risk factor for women, regardless of age, height, features of the figure, is the waist size is more than 80 cm, and for men - more than 94 cm. If your volumes exceed these figures, you should pay attention to your health. Incorrect nutrition, extra calories, genetics, lifestyle, age - all this plays a role in the accumulation of visceral fat.

Thinking about how to get rid of visceral fat, people think that it is much more difficult to do than get rid of subcutaneous fat, but it is not. When you lose weight, this type of fat is the first to go away. If you are concerned about a problem called visceral fat, how to remove it, then the first step to this will be a balanced diet and physical activity.

It's simple: in order for visceral fat to disappear, you need exercise and a proper, healthy diet. Fat in general is unallocated calories. When a person consumes more calories than he spends. These calories, which are superfluous, in the form of fat are deposited in your body. To make this fat disappear, you need to consume less calories or as much as you waste. Count on calories, eat the right healthy food, give your body physical activity, and you will defeat visceral fat.

The greatest benefit in getting rid of visceral fat will be aerobic exercises. Green tea combined with exercise helps burn calories and get rid of internal fat. Blueberry has the same property.

As you can see, the secret of getting rid of visceral fat is simple: move more and eat less.
